Help your kids process big feelings, build a social-emotional tool kit, and find beauty in life's challenges with this creative story that expresses the hope of the gospel from podcast host, speaker, and mom Toni Collier.
Avery has big emotions and bubbling anxieties about changes in her life. When her crayons break as she scribbles furiously, she discovers that they have personalities and feelings too! And they can show her how to use her love of coloring to manage scary, overwhelming feelings and embrace curiosity and joy. As Avery follows the crayons' advice, gets creative, and chooses bravery and positive thinking, she discovers that God can use her to make beautiful things, even with broken crayons.

With a fun story, silly crayon characters, and practical guidance for kids struggling with powerful emotions, insecurity, and perfectionism, Broken Crayons Still Color will entertain children as it assures them that God is making a beautiful masterpiece out of things they thought were broken. The presentation page and deluxe dust jacket make this encouraging book a beautiful gift for back-to-school, kids facing new experiences and tough situations, and any child with big feelings.
Acerca de los autores:
TONI COLLIER is the founder of Broken Crayons Still Color, a global organization that helps women and children process through brokenness and get to healing and hope. Toni has encouraged thousands through her vibrant voice and vulnerable storytelling. She is a speaker, host of the Still Coloring podcast, and author of two books: Brave Enough to Be Broken and a children's book, Broken Crayons Still Color. Toni is teaching people all over the globe that you can be broken and still worthy or feel unqualified and still be called to do great things.
Whitney Bak is a writer and editor who has worked on over two hundred titles, including multiple New York Times bestsellers. She brings a fresh perspective to every project and a passion for helping authors share their unique and diverse stories. Whitney enjoys blogging and scrapbooking about her experiences living in Europe and Asia, which she believes have helped her bring a more global perspective to her work. She also enjoys writing novels and is an avid audiobook listener.
Natalie Vasilica was born in Chisinau, Moldova. As a child, she spent her time in the countryside, surrounded by fields and farm animals. Today nature, animals, and children are the main inspiration for her drawings. She prefers to mix traditional mediums with digital tools to create a unique feeling in her illustrations, and she’s always on the lookout for new techniques. Natalie is based in the Netherlands and lives with her husband and pet budgie, Jeni, by the seaside. She spends her free time traveling and discovering the world.
